Runbook: Checkout Load Test (Cartographer)

Run load tests against the staging checkout only — never prod. Ramp to 500 rps over 10 minutes, hold 30. Watch payment-stub latency; abort if p99 exceeds 2s. Reset the synthetic inventory pool after each run or subsequent tests will fail on stock checks. Abort procedures and dashboard links are on the internal page here.

operations page: https://jenkins.zemvarcloud.local/job/merge_requests/repo/build/73930b4b30f0a8ed

## Sensor drift: what to do at 3am

If the GrowLoop controller starts reporting humidity swings that don't match the backup probes in the Fernwick greenhouse, it's almost always sensor drift, not an actual climate event. Don't panic and don't touch the vents manually. First, restart the calibration daemon and give it ten minutes to re-baseline. If readings still disagree by more than 5%, flip the controller into safe mode. The safe-mode thresholds it will use are these.

config for yahap-bajof:
[istix]
host = istix.qorvelsys.internal
user = istix_svc
database = istix_prod

Ticket: Config drift on soft deletes — Ostermill orders table

Prod and staging disagree on soft-delete behavior. Staging sets the deleted flag and retains rows 90 days; prod is hard-deleting after the Farrow purge job runs. Support sees 'missing order' reports as a result. Do not manually restore rows. Staging is the source of truth, and its current settings are as follows.

deployment values, kajep-kageg:
[praix]
host = praix.paliqcorp.corp
user = praix_svc
database = praix_prod